Information about "Mullineux Schist Chenin Blanc 2024"
The Mullineux Schist Chenin Blanc 2024 is sourced from the distinctive schist soils of Swartland, offering a vibrant freshness characterized by notes of Asian pear and quince. This straw-yellow gem delights with its terroir-driven aromas of lime and peach. The exceptional texture and savory finish make it a standout, ensuring pure enjoyment in every sip.
These wines, originating from a single terroir, reflect a genuine sense of place. Each label bears the estate's name with pride, acknowledging the dedication of its producers.
The grapes were hand-harvested early in the morning. No additional yeast was added, allowing the natural, wild yeast to initiate fermentation. The wine was aged on fine lees for six months and then matured for another eleven months in older 500L French oak barrels.
